Subject: Rotation notice — SQL lint service key

Team,

Ahead of the weekly sync: we've rotated the credential for Grindlequery, the internal service that enforces our SQL linting rules in CI. The old key was embedded in a shared pre-commit hook, which violated our own rule about secrets in tracked files — noted irony. New lint rules for migration files land next sprint. Update your local hook config; the replacement key follows below.

service key, fawip-bajef: kto11_Qt5wZK9vdNC

# Crashlump Environments

Quick rundown for support folks: the Crashlump crash-report pipeline has three environments — dev, staging, and prod. Reports from the Pebbleworks mobile apps land in staging first if the build is flagged as beta; everything else goes straight to prod. Dev is for our own testing only, so ignore it. The prod ingest tier currently runs with these values.

settings of fawip-yadug:
[druath]
port = 3000
region = north-4
host = druath.qirvanworks.corp
timeout_ms = 1500
retries = 1

Subject: DR Drill — TaxRate Cache Restore (Quillbrook)

Hi Mara,

For Thursday's drill we'll restore the Quillbrook tax-rate lookup cache from the cold snapshot, then replay the last rate bulletin to verify freshness. Please block two hours and keep the staging writers paused throughout. The restore tool will ask once for the recovery passphrase, which appears below.

vault phrase of tajef-tafog = istox-sorax-zorox-casok-holox-kelix-weneth-drueth-casion